3M CompanyMMMNYSE
Loading
Analyst Sentiment
Analysts lean bullish — 56% recommend buying.
Consensus Rating
Buy
18 analysts·Moderate coverage
56%
Rating Distribution
Strong Buy
00%
Buy
1056%
Hold
739%
Sell
16%
Strong Sell
00%
Analyst ratings reflect Wall Street opinion, not guarantees. Historical accuracy varies by firm and sector.
Price Target Expectations
Current price is 1% above analyst consensus — near fair value expected.
Bear Case
$136.00
-21%
Consensus
$169.50
-1%
Bull Case
$190.00
+11%
Price Range18 analysts
Low
Consensus
High
$136.00
$190.00
Current Target
Current Price
$171.82
Above Target
$2.32
Price targets are 12-month forecasts. Actual results depend on earnings, market conditions, and sector trends.
Earnings & Revenue Estimates
2026E$8.67(9 analysts)
P/E28x
Current: 28.2xActual
Estimate
Range (Low–High)
Forward Growth Estimates (YoY)
FY2027
Rev+3.35%
EPS+8.88%
FY2028
Rev+3.41%
EPS+8.12%
FY2029
Rev+3.24%
EPS+11.98%
Earnings Surprises
Beat rate:100%(12/12 quarters)
Avg surprise:+10.7%
Beat
Miss
Inline
Estimate